
There's speculation regarding the Chief Minister's decision to swap the Ministers for Home Affairs and Tourism.
Tony Brown says the change will give Adrian Earnshaw and Martyn Quayle a wider view of government.
Trade Unionist and political activist Bernard Moffatt thinks it was unusual for the announcement to have been kept so quiet.
